Dictionary definition
CIVILIZE, verb. Teach or refine to be discriminative in taste or judgment; "Cultivate your musical taste"; "Train your tastebuds"; "She is well schooled in poetry".
CIVILIZE, verb. Raise from a barbaric to a civilized state; "The wild child found wandering in the forest was gradually civilized".
